Re: Did you get a bassinet?
No you don't have to have one BUT it IS helpful depending on your situation, comfort level etc. Some people are perfectly comfortable putting their newborns directly into their crib - I didn't for comfort reasons and BF reasons - but you can if you are okay with it.
I would highly recommend one if you plan to BF. I didn't buy one and planned on using the pack n play bassinet for a short time - but then I ended up with a surprise c-section and my parents and DH thought it would be easier if we had a bassinet right next to the bed (we couldn't do that with our pack n play not enough room where our bed is). So they got me one before I left the hospital.
If you plan to BF it is so helpful, and even easier if you have a section. I could reach in and pull her out BF and put her right back in without getting out of bed at night - so it was easier to go right back to sleep. The one I had went to 18lbs - so you could keep the baby in your room longer if you feel that is right for you. DD stayed with us until 5 months - much longer than we planned b/c DH didn't get to put up the monitor for a while. But that was what worked for us.

No, you don't "need" a bassinet. When I had my DD 4 years ago, I didn't register for one- I didn't think I needed it.
I had the crib in her room, the pack and play in my room and a dome sleep/play thing.
I was all for putting her in her crib in her own room, until we brought her home. I couldn't sleep with her so far away from us. The pack and and play wasn't great either, it didn't seem too comfortable. The sleep/play dome was on the floor, and I couldn't keep bending down because of the unexpected c-section.
So, I went out and got a bassinet. I got it at Babies-R-Us, and it cost about $100. I got a unisex one, and will be using it soon for baby #2.
The baby can sleep in most of them until about 15 lbs. For us, that was a little over 3 months, some babies who are smaller, can stay in longer.
Ours rocked and also had wheels, so I could bring it into other areas of the house.
